Chapter 5340: Disagreement
The change in Mu Qingya was considerable; Qiao Mu felt a tremor in her heart just watching through the window. If Mu Qingya had only lost some weight, it would have been one thing. But her current appearance was completely emaciated, beyond recognition. Her entire being was shriveled, as if she had lost all moisture, looking like a walking mummy. Her hair was dry and yellowish, hanging in wisps, here and there, plastered to her scalp. Her hands and feet were also so withered that only bones remained, as if they would break with a mere touch.
This woman bore no resemblance to the gentle, dignified, and bright-as-water figure from memory. Her eyes were lifeless and sunken, her entire face shrunken to half the size of a palm. She opened her mouth, trying to speak, but was completely cut off by Mu Xiaoxue's scolding.
Mu Xiaoxue was like a madwoman at this moment, her hands sliding up and down, repeatedly shouting, "Do you think I'm like you? I won't be like you. I just need all three transformations to succeed! Then I can become the most perfect person in this world."
"And the Patriarch promised me. As long as I serve him well in the future, he will never mistreat me. At worst, I still have the Qiankun Reversal Talisman to help me. I'll be fine, I still have a chance."
Mu Qingya's sunken eyes widened like a full moon, staring intently at her foolish daughter. Hot tears streamed uncontrollably from her parched eyes. Mu Qingya laboriously slammed her hand against the ground, the sound from her throat rough and filled with sorrow, as if a carriage wheel had rolled over it a dozen times.
"It's, it's me, it's me who protected you too, too well. So much so that... you, you are so naive." Looking at her foolish daughter, Mu Qingya couldn't help but burst into tears, heartbroken and filled with remorse.
Having stayed in Heavenly Fate for so many years, she knew the disposition of Heavenly Fate's high-ranking officials better than anyone. They would entice you with small favors as long as you were useful to them. Once you lost any bit of utility, you would die a more desolate and tragic death than anyone else. One only needed to look at her to know.
When she, as the esteemed Hall Master of Flying Heaven, infiltrated the Talisman-wielding aristocratic families, often secretly helping to gather resources and transmit news from the capital, how much attention and importance the organization placed on her! But once her identity was exposed, and she hastily failed or even fled, her subsequent fortunes plummeted. Heavenly Fate did not need useless individuals occupying resources. Moreover, she was merely an ordinary person who couldn't do anything. In the eyes of Heavenly Fate's high-ranking officials, she had already lost her value and was not worth their continued investment.
This was why she had fallen to such a state. If it weren't for the organization still wanting to observe the secondary drug reaction on her, they probably wouldn't have bothered to rescue her from Snow Island.
Did she hate? Of course, she hated! Her entire life, Mu Qingya's, had turned out like this.
Did she regret? She couldn't say for sure. Perhaps a little, but if she hadn't joined Heavenly Fate back then, she would have remained a mediocre housewife her entire life. Spending her days revolving around her in-laws and husband, she would have been nothing more than an ordinary woman of the inner chambers throughout her existence. Such a life, she naturally resented even more!
"Mother, what are you saying! You're not happy for me, and now you're constantly cursing me!" Mu Xiaoxue screamed.
"Do you think your daughter will be as unlucky as you?"
